IMO I wouldn't. There are plenty of different kinds of food out there to feed them. You can feed them worms, super worms or since your is so small ,meal worms, krill, pellets, crickets. water plants (Anacharis), romaine lettuce. Think of what they would eat in the wild. Normally they wouldn't eat a mouse.
